'Blacked-up' fan causes Spain controversy

A 'blacked-up' spectator is seen at the Spanish Grand Prix over a year after Lewis Hamilton suffered racist abuse at the Circuit de Catalunya which prompted the FIA to launch an anti-racism campaign.
